On June 1, 2013, the minister of Petroleum & Natural Gas, formally launched the scheme direct benefit transfer for LPG (DBTL) Scheme in 20 high Aadhaar coverage districts. On receiving the first subsidized cylinder subsidy for next will again get credited in their bank account, which can then be available for the purchase of the next cylinder at market rate until the cap of 12 cylinders per year is reached. Direct benefit transfer(DBT) involves transfer of government benefits like subsidies directly into bank account of beneficiaries. However, DBT faces challenges like Infrastructure in remote areas- Banks, ICT; financial illiteracy, exclusion errors which limit its effectiveness. UPSC: PIB Summary and Analysis Dec 29 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) Scheme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) is Government’s major reform initiative to re-engineer the existing delivery processes, ensuring better and timely delivery of benefits using Information & Communication Technology (ICT).
